摘 要:目的运用Meta分析方法汇总并评价体素内不相干运动扩散加权成像(IVIM-DWI)对肺癌与肺部良性病变的鉴别诊断效能。方法在PubMed、Web of Science、中国知网(CNKI)和万方数据库中检索自建库以来至2020年6月发表的有关IVIM-DWI鉴别肺癌和肺部良性病变的中英文文献,对纳入文献进行质量评价后提取相关数据,应用Review Manager 5.3对2组病变纯扩散系数(D)值、灌注相关扩散系数(D*)值和灌注分数(f)值的平均值及标准差进行分析,比较2组病变标准化平均数差值(SMD)的差异。利用Stata 12.0合并各指标的诊断效能。结果共纳入文献12篇,含肺癌529例,肺部良性病变306例。除D*值外(SMD=0.01,P=0.96),肺癌的D值(SMD=-1.02,P<0.001)及f值(SMD=-0.43,P=0.005)均低于肺部良性病变,差异有统计学意义。D值的诊断效能最高,其敏感度、特异度、曲线下面积(AUC)、验后概率分别为89%、71%、0.90、57%,其次为f值(敏感度、特异度、AUC、验后概率分别为71%、61%、0.71、43%)和D*值(敏感度、特异度、AUC、验后概率分别为70%、60%、0.66、43%)。结论IVIM-DWI可用于肺部良恶性病变性质的诊断,其中以D值的诊断效能最高。Objective To summarize and evaluate the diagnostic performance of intravoxel incoherent motion diffusion weighted imaging(IVIM-DWI)in differentiating benign lung lesions from lung cancer via a Meta-analysis method.Methods The studies publised at home and abroad regarding the differential diagnosis of lung cancer and benign lung lesions based on IVIM-DWI were systemically searched via PubMed,Web of Science,China National Knowledge Infrastructure(CNKI)and Wanfang database from inception to June 2020.Data extracted from the eligible literatures after performing quality assessment,including the mean value,standard deviation and the standardized mean difference(SMD)of the D value,the D*value as well as the f value,were calculated and measured via Review Manager 5.3,and Stata 12.0 was performed to combine their diagnostic performances with each other.Results A total of 12 studies with 529 lung cancer and 306 benign lung lesions were finally included.D value(SMD=-1.02,P<0.001)and f value(SMD=-0.43,P=0.005)of lung cancer were significantly lower than those of benign lung lesions,while there was no significant difference in D*value(SMD=0.01,P=0.96)between lung cancer and benign lung lesions.The D value demonstrated the best diagnostic performance in differentiating lung cancer from benign lung lesions,[sensitivity=89%,specificity=71%,area under the curve(AUC)=0.90 and post-test probability=57%,respectively]followed by f value(sensitivity=71%,specificity=61%,AUC=0.71 and post-test probability=43%,respectively)and D*value(sensitivity=70%,specificity=60%,AUC=0.66 and post-test probability=43%,respectively).Conclusion The IVIM-DWI parameters,particularly D value,show potentially strong diagnostic capabilities in the differential diagnosis of benign from malignant lung lesions.
